Types of building materials and solar greenhouses for growing vegetables.



- Acrylic is resistant to weathering, does not break easily and is very transparent. Radiation absorption rate is higher than the glass; almost double acrylic sheet transmits 83% of light and reduce the amount of heat lost only 20-40%. The material does not yellow. The downside is that is that it can catch fire, is expensive and is easily scratched.
- Polycarbonate better withstand impact and is more flexible, easier and cheaper than acrylic. Double polycarbonate sheets transmit about 75-80% of the light and reduce heat loss to 40%. The material scratches easily, has a high rate of contraction in about a year begins to turn yellow and lose its transparency.
- panels of polyester fiberglass are durable, look good and have a moderate price. Compared with glass panels are more resistant to impact and send a little less light; while turn yellow.
- polyethylene panels are very cheap but can be used only temporarily, it does not look very well and have maintained more carefully than others. It is quickly destroyed by the sun's ultraviolet rays; if treated with special substances lasts 12-24 months longer than untreated ones.
- polyvinyl have a very high rate of emission of radiation and thus increase the temperature in the greenhouse during the night. It is more expensive than polyethylene and tends to accumulate dust.

Temperature control in the cultivation of vegetables in the greenhouse and tunnels, the ventilation system of the plant.


temperature control
This is very important in the greenhouse, both vegetative development, as well as fruit. To determine the level of heat required, you first need to know it needs minimum temperatures each culture, the minimum temperature outside the greenhouse and conservatory area. Wind and settlement greenhouse affect heat loss.
And cooling is just as important. Evaporative cooling is an efficient and economical method to lower the temperature in the greenhouse. A proper ventilation is important not only for temperature control and to replace the amount of carbon dioxide and humidity control. A moisture content above 90% result in the occurrence of plant diseases. Most often used for greenhouses fans on the roof and the side plastic panels for ventilation and cooling. Fans should be installed as high as possible on the wall. Late spring or early summer may need to be shadowed emissions, if temperatures climb too much.
Heating, cooling and ventilation must be provided by automated systems to ensure perfect conditions and to facilitate your work.

The soil type used in the cultivation of plants in a greenhouse.


Soil easiest way to start growing vegetables in greenhouses is nearby land use, provided it is well drained. Land quality can be improved if seadauga manure or compost, before coming fumigation. Earth must be fumigated or sterilized with steam at least two weeks before planting vegetables. If it is sterilized by steam, maintain a temperature of 82C for at least 4 hours. Avoid deep cultivation after sterilization to prevent reintroduction of weed seeds and pests below the level it broke sterilization.
Before planting good quality testing ground to determine the amount of fertilizer to be applied to each crop. All substances phosphorus and potassium fertilizers must be applied before planting or incorporated directly into the ground. Fertilizing with nitrogen is applied in stages: one before planting and the rest in during the development period. Other secondary fertilizing substances applies only when necessary.

Parameters and conditions required for optimum seed germination of tomato are:
The optimum temperature for germination is between: 22 to 26 o C. The temperature for germination should not be less than 15 o C.
Humidity 100%
The complete absence of light in the first few days until the emergence (or non-coating paper board).
If the substrate is used for sowing professional technological operations are as follows:
Peat moss is wet with water up to complete wetting;
Draw lines through a slight pressure to the substrate;
Rows drawn on peat substrate semanre
Place the seeds one at a time;
Seeding the seedbed in peat substrate
It is covered with a thin layer of substrate of 0.5 cm maximum (no more than small as tomato seed germination, or too much weight too high above the layer greatly delay the emergence);
No more wet then - due to the small grain of peat or subsequent addition of water leads to the discovery of seeds or their deeper burial. And in one case and in another emergence will be uneven;
Cover with newspaper paper or paperboard, the seed bed over which the foil can put a restraint role as long as the moisture necessary for germination of 100% and the optimum răsării tomatoes; Careful!!! This method foil to cover the seedbed applies only to sow tomatoes in winter when sunlight intensity is low and does not create problems of tomatoes; especially during the spring and summer are not used in any form of seed coating film because it leads to choking and destruction of seedlings.
It ensures a constant temperature day / night from 22 to 26 ° C but not more than 15 ° C; lower temperatures between 15-18 ° C irremediably affects tomatoes not only greatly delay the germination and emergence (up to 2 weeks).
If temperatures are optimal start to appear 3-6 days after the first plant, and after the phenomenon of emergence takes place in the table removes coatings to prevent elongation sized seedling emergence, even if emergence is not 100%.

All of the above technological steps are fulfilled where the drilling alveolar trays with the proviso that it is seeded with one single seed in each alveolar cell.

After emergence of the seedlings is necessary to change the complete constant day temperature / night temperature with alternating day / night, and it is necessary that during the day the temperature is between 22-26 ° C and night 16-20 o C. This alternation is required for optimum seedling development sites. A constant temperature day / night or a higher temperature during the night than during the day will result in accelerated growth of the strain (strain thin) at the expense of the plant mass represented by the leaflets, thick stem and root volume. It also aims substrate moisture which will irrigate constant throughout the period until subcultures. With irrigation and fertilization can be made and treatment plant must if sowing was done in the ground or mixed with soil. Fertilization is made in this period, compared with balanced mineral NPK fertilizer (20:20:20 Solufeed), the addition of magnesium and trace elements. Very small doses of fertilizers are 10-20 g / 10 liters of water (0.1 to 0.2%), in place of using 1 tablespoon NPK fertilizer (20:20:20 Solufeed) in a bucket of water. Also for the smooth development of the root system and a small resistance at the seedling stresses sites may be used by wetting or spraying nimble at a dose of 10 ml / 10 liters of water. Phytosanitary treatments in this period include a fungicide against falling seedlings complex (to avoid the risk of phytotoxicity Previcur recommended dose is 0.15% - at this dose did not burn or frunzuliţele top of the young), an insecticide against insects that occur immediately heated space where they like. We recommend as an insecticide for the first phase of development of SMEs is Actara seedling at a dose of 0.02% - the benefits of using this insecticide related systemic its total ity and very important is that the plant can get through the root system is easily transported peaks rise protecting plants efficiently and indoor precisely where it is most sensitive and which are most often attacked by insects, also reached peaks rising Actara induce an effect of biostimulation of meristems growth, an added advantage when used in early stages of development. If there is a risk of mites is recommended to use a acaricide like Vertimec or Milbeknock. The density of the culture of tomato plants used in the first cycle is between 40000-45000 plants / hectare. This density can be reached in the first cycle as vegetative plants have stronger spring power, tomatoes floors 3-6 are left as they are broken peaks, so that high density does not create a strongly limiting plant stress.
As a method of planting two variants can be used: distance equal distance between alternate rows and between rows (two closely followed by 2 below). The most used method is the cycle with alternating distance between rows, for example, close spacing of 60 cm, and the distance between the rows 90 cm distant. The distance between the plants should be 30-35 cm, so 40-45000 there is provided a plant density / ha.

Irrigation, with proper preparation of the soil before planting, is one of the most important factors leading to the success of vegetable crops. Below are some basic principles regarding irrigation of vegetables in greenhouses and solariums:
1. The recommended method of irrigation tomatoes in hothouses and greenhouses is drip irrigation; (see advantages)
2. tomato crops drip irrigation system used must fulfill the following conditions;
a) a throughput of 1.6 to 2.5 L / h / dispensing water at a pressure of 0.5 to 1 atm
b) be the distance between the peaks of 20-30 cm (Note that it is a condition that the dropper to be the base of the stem of tomatoes, but drip line should be as close to the plant);
3. irrigation must always be morning as possible (recommended is 1-2 hours before sunrise)
4. The watering must be done often and consistently as possible, the recommended frequency is every day with some water combined with environmental conditions: fewer cold days and more on hot days;
5. is added to each irrigation and fertilizers, respecting the principle of "as much as possible in as small portions" (fertilization teaspoon); thus the recommended dose weekly will be applied daily in equal portions to the number of applications made - for example, if we apply one kg of a particular fertilizer on the week and the week will be five irrigation at each irrigation will apply 1: 5 = 0.2 kg fertilizer / irrigation. Thus the plant will use all the manure and will not suffer from shock saline due to large amounts of fertilizer application.

Copilirea
Breaking shoots or copilirea is recommended to be done before the sprout length of 5 cm to attain. If lăstărirea is to sprout has 5 cm scar wounds quickly, the plant heal faster and not suffer from this operation. If delay copilitul plant will begin to turn to shoot much of the products of photosynthesis at the expense of fruit growing, the decreased appearance of new leaves and blossoms, the wound caused by rupture is much larger and harder to cure, turning true input in the gates of the disease. In any case regardless of when it was lăstărirea, the operation wounds plant (wound small or large to increase them in the atmosphere is a gateway to the plant) and immediately after completion of the work is given a fungicide (as the best properties of scarring if possible) to protect the plant from possible infection with pathogens present in the air. Note that whenever performing operations that create open wounds should immediately come up with a treatment plant for plant protection from possible illnesses.

For tomatoes early and extratimpurii to hasten fruit maturity breaking operation is performed immediately after the appearance of peaks last inflorescences. This operation is called meat. Breaking peak is after the last bloom but keeping at least one leaf or two with function "pull sap." In this way all the products of photosynthesis are directed towards the fruit, and the time required to reach maturity is reduced considerably.

Traditionally tomato fruits are harvested when they reach maturity biological, ie when the fruit changes color from green to red. This harvest no longer practice in large pools vegetables through the use of new hybrids of tomatoes valuable genetic hybrids that have properties POSTMATURARE: harvested ripe fruits reach maturity commercial (dark red color and sweet taste) flawless ( yellow spots, soft, altered, etc.)! For this reason hybrids that have this property very important postmaturare recommended harvesting the first fruits - the fruits begin to change color from green to orange or pink. This is the right time for harvesting for hybrids Amanda F1, Lady Rosa F1, F1 Rosaliya . Below is the right time for harvesting in these Tomato.

Density are planted peppers and brightness depends on climate zone. The recommended planting density peppers in greenhouses / tunnels is 30000-35000 plants / Ha. May be planted in rows with equal distance between them and the second most common method is to close rows (40-60 cm) and two spaced apart (1.0 - 1.2m). The distance between plants should be between 30-40 cm.
